Output ed7b508018cbb95c099581e528781eaa424d0e8564200a896c0596590441571e:54

value
332142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72067e754dcf1e2d5d67d38c5bdf90ca23e3b26c OP_EQUAL
address
3C5vjd2GSmSh7CTutDA8cmJRtPpyfr7jgy
transaction
ed7b508018cbb95c099581e528781eaa424d0e8564200a896c0596590441571e
spent
true